Police probe fatal Faleatiu shooting

By Pai Mulitalo Ale 14 September 2016, 12:00AM

The Police are investigating the death of a 60-year-old father who was shot dead at Faleatiu at the end of last month.

Confirmed by Police Media Officer, Su’a Muliaga Tiumalu, he told the Samoa Observer they are still searching for suspects.

“All I can say at this stage is that there is an investigation,” he said.

“The investigation team has some leads and they are following it but the investigation is continuing and I cannot discuss the details.”

The body of the elderly man was discovered by villagers about 300 meters from his home.

Su’a said the Police have been told that the deceased man went to fetch coconuts that morning when the incident happened. 

He said police found wounds on the back of his head and on his back when his body was taken to the hospital.

He confirmed that the injuries sustained by the deceased man are from a gun. 

Su’a said they are still waiting for a gun expert to examine the bullets found on the deceased to confirm the type of weapon used.
